Adverse Drug Reactions Induced by Gatifloxacin:Analysis of 866 Cases During 2003~2006 / 中国药房

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E:

To study the characteristics of adverse drug reactions(ADR) induced by gatifloxacin.

METHODS:

A total of 866 ADR cases induced by gatifloxacin collected in Zhejiang ADR Monitoring Center between Oct.30,2003 and Oct.30,2006 were analyzed with Excel.

RESULTS:

The common ADR induced by gatifloxacin were lesions of skin and appendages,gastro-intestinal system,systemic and nervous system.Most of the cases were slight in symptoms,but gatifloxacin could also induce severe ADR such as dysglycemia etc that resulting in potential risks to vital human organs.

CONCLUSION:

ADR monitoring should be emphasized when using gatifloxacin so as to decrease or avoid the occurrence of ADR.
